What, if it is impossible for gravity to collapse an object tight enough to form event horizon in the first place?
I bet you are aware of so called virtual particles.
In sufficiently dense environment ones with positive energy are "forced into reality" and leaving contracting matter ball as radiation, while negative energy counterpart work towards decreasing of mass of collapsing body...so event horizon actually never forms.
Under this scenario nothing can be squizzed fast enough to form event horizon, before it cease to exist.
Such objects are known as magnetospheric eternally collapsing objects (as they would display magnetic fields) and their existance would imply nonexistance of BH.
Detailed astronomical observations would distinguish between MECO and BH.

That is definition of BH/event horizon, but not definition of singularity.
If you found yourself in BH with ring singularity (rotating Kerr type BH, in practice any BH, if it exist at all), you would observe singularity emitting light in fact, but light would not leave the hole and would be falling back on singularity).
You would also fail to leave that hole, even if you tried...
Should the hole rotate fast enough, event horizons would "merge" and disappear and you would be observing glowing singularity from the distance.
That would be naked singularity, the one which is not locked in the hole.
You would also observe the environment, where our laws of physics (including concept of causality) are no longer working.
